Lessons Learned – Takeaways for Every Single

  1. Seasonal spikes are opportunities, not miracles. Use them to gather data, refine your profile, and test new features.
  2. Leverage the matching algorithm by providing detailed preferences. The more specific you are, the better the algorithm can serve you.
  3. Verification matters. Choosing verified members reduces scams and improves conversation depth.
  4. Video dates are a safe bridge between texting and meeting in person. They help you gauge chemistry while staying protected.
  5. Stay active year‑round. A quiet period is a chance to refresh your profile and plan the next engagement phase.
